'France Football' revealed the nominees for this year's prize

The names were given throughout the day on Monday

The 30 nominees for the Ballon d'Or won't be a secret for much longer. The magazine France Football, who give the prize, will announce the players up for the award throughout Monday, between 09.00 and 19.15 hours. 

Every hour, the magazine will reveal more names, with Cristiano Ronaldo and Lionel Messi one again the clear favourites for the award. If Ronaldo wins it, he will match the five won previously by Messi. 

Neymar was in the first batch of nominees with Barcelona's Luis Suarez and Liverpool's Philippe Coutinho in the second set of five, which was revealed at midday. 

Finally, later in the afternoon, the two favourites, Ronaldo and Messi were confirmed as being on the shortlist. 

There were six lots of five nominees announced and here are the final 30.
